Enhanced Seat Belt Use Reminder System
(BeltAlert)
If the occupied driver’s seat belt has not been buckled
within 60 seconds of starting the vehicle and if the vehicle
speed is greater than 5 mph (8 km/h), BeltAlert will
alert the driver to buckle the seat belt. The driver should
also instruct all other occupants to buckle their seat belts.
Once the warning is triggered, BeltAlert will continue to
chime and flash the Seat Belt Reminder Light for 96 sec-
onds or until the driver’s seat belt is buckled.
BeltAlert will be reactivated if the driver’s seat belt is
unbuckled for more than 10 seconds and the vehicle
speed is greater than 5 mph (8 km/h).
